Mission Statement
"Education Through Preservation" The Rock County Historical Society, a quasi-public membership organization, preserves, advances and disseminates knowledge of the history of Rock County, Wisconsin, by identifying, collecting, preserving, protecting, and interpreting prehistoric and historic cultural resources relating to the history of the county. The Society serves as a regional history research and cultural center. The Society will also collect selected national subjects germane to the historic sites it operates, or to certain specified local industries, activities or phenomena. The Society endeavors through its programs to enrich the communities of Rock County and to contribute to an understanding and appreciation of their history and of Wisconsin and American heritage and culture.
